Synopsis
No time to delay. Do what you were born to do.
These are the words that ring in the mind of mild-mannered, beloved schoolteacher Cora Gundersun- just before she takes her own life, and many others; in a shocking act of carnage. When the disturbing contents of her secret journal are discovered, it seems certain that she must have been insane. But Jane Hawk knows better.
In the wake of her husband's inexplicable suicide-and the equally mysterious deaths of scores of other exemplary individuals-Jane picks up the trail of a secret cabal of powerful players who think themselves above the law and above punshiment. But the ruthless people bent on hijacking America's future for their own monstrous ends never banked on a highly trained FBI agent willing to go rogue-aned become the nation's most wonated fugitive-in order to derail their insidious planes to gain absolute power with a terrifying breakthrough.
My Thoughts
As always Koontz brings the characters to life with their complex situations. This situation is very complex. Jane pursue's the people who have brought this conspiracy to life and also caused her husband's suicide. She has to go rogue to catch these people. She has to deal with people who have nanotechnology and that can be terrifying.
This was definitely one that you need to pay attention to when listening to it or reading it. Whispering Room has a lot of twists and turns and boy it is just a definite page turner. It is excellently written, and a very good book.
